Feeling of strong annoyance was observed when students of central university of Gujarat saw news

Maruti Suzuki one of leading automobile company showed interest to invest about 1800 crores Rupees in state to setting up a manufacturing plant. State under a tag of development claimed that it’ll provide land and other incentives if this plant is established in Gujarat with a notion that this plant will generate employment opportunities in state. What a wonderful idea!!!!

This idea proved as failure to me when I read news stating that land chosen for setting up central university was given away for maruti Suzuki plant by state government in popular domestic newspaper (http://www.sandesh.com/sandesh_article.aspx?newsid=343693).

Simple logic was seems to be out of bound (to me) that; how state will be able to provide employment without generating educated (and even qualified) workforce?  And that too in private sector whose recruitment policies are out of reach of state.

Even this state (Gujarat) like other states doesn’t institutional mechanism to handle migration which can lead to series of rationalistic issues. Who’ll be responsible for taking urbanization issues which are going to emerge due this plant? Its seems to be sign of stupidity when someone repeats its mistakes again. State proved failure in terms TATA small car plant, whose product claimed to hit automobile market but getting worst of market even after providing land (acquired by farmers) and cheep loans.
